An arrangement picked from my home garden on Saturday for this stormy Monday.
I’ve loved using this compote all season. I find it’s warmer blush tones suit many of the blooms in my garden. Also I’m using a flower frog in here so it’s all environmentally friendly which I love as well that nothing is wasted.
Roses - Charles Darwin, Koko Loko and Francis Meilland.
Japanese Anemones - besotted with these airy dancers in an arrangement.
Dahlias - KA’s Mocha Jo, Peaches ‘N Cream, Appleblossom, Platinum Blonde, Jessie G, Lark’s Ebbe, Floret Seedlings, Coralie, Take Off, Koko Puff and others.

Valley Rust Bucket from Hailey .merle.farm nails the fall color tones.
Some names of the dahlias I grow are personal names of the breeder but this one named Valley Rust Bucket makes me smile every time I see these deep rusty russet tones in the field as it’s so well named. This is a prolific bloomer with 3” perfectly shaped balls with super long stems that hover above the plant canopy making them a joy to cut.
